Web项目常用技术整理

一.数据库配置yml

spring:

  datasource:

      url:jdbc://mysql:///(三个/代表本地数据库)Ctrl(数据库名字)?serverTimezone=UTC(设置 )

      usrname:root

      password:*******

      driver-class-name:com.mysql.cj.jdbc.Driver

后端文件在连接数据库的时候,需要用@Autowired作为注解,这个注解对类成员变量方法构造函数进行标记,完成自动装配工作,注解嘛,就是方便

@Autowired

Datasource datasource

连接的时候:Connection c = datasource.getConnection();

二.Java 数据库连接常用语句

PreparedStatement ps = c.prepareStatement("SQL语句");

1.如果SQL语句需要拼接

调用方法 ps.setString(index,String);

ps.excuteUpdate();

2.如果SQL语句不需要拼接

ps.excuteQuery();

然后用Resultset的对象来拿到运行结果即可

在遍历运行结果的时候调用ResultSet的next()发法

3.异常

try{},catch(Exception ex){}

三.ajax的使用

$.ajax({

  url:http://localhost:8080/请求的名字,

  data:{"name":x_name},采用键值对的方法,后端通过name来获取数据

   success:function(){}

})

四.JSON的使用

JSON:JavaScript Object Notation (JS对象表示)

后端用List<Object> list = new ArrayList<>();

String result = JSONArray.toJSONString(list);

List可以重复,并且是有序的,有序是指放入数据的先后有序

前端用var x = JSON.parse(data)来把JSON串变回List

五.Springboot注解

函数体外部用@RequestController

内部用RequestMapping("/ajax")处理请求

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值